Unfortunately for Rittenhouse, the motion filed by his lawyers to prevent extradition was denied by the Lake County Circuit Court on Friday. It is feared that this will lead to Rittenhouse receiving a politically-motivated kangaroo court trial in which he will be tried as an adult.

“According to Illinois law, this Illinois court shall not rule on the State of Wisconsin’s statutes that charge a 17-year-old as an adult. According to Illinois law, an Illinois court cannot opine on the safety or alleged lack thereof of Rittenhouse in the State of Wisconsin,” the court stated in their decision

“These questions…are not to be addressed in an Illinois extradition proceeding. These are matters that can be raised in Kenosha County, Wisconsin, through pre-trial proceedings or during trial,” they added.
